Runbook: Quartzel query planner regression. Symptom: SELECTs on the ledger tables jump from ~40ms to 3s+ after stats refresh. Cause: planner picks nested-loop join when row estimates skew low. Mitigation: disable adaptive join selection and re-analyze the affected tables; do not bump work memory first, it masks the issue. Verify plans with EXPLAIN before closing the incident. Apply the mitigation by restarting the planner service with these settings.

config for bahif-yahag:
[druath]
port = 5432
region = central-4
host = druath.tolvaqsys.corp
timeout_ms = 500
retries = 6

Subject: Key rotation — Slimforge build service

Team,

As part of the image slimming rollout, the Slimforge service key is being rotated today. Slimforge strips debug symbols and unused layers from our Corbel base images, cutting average image size by roughly 60%. Reviewers should confirm that PRs touching the build pipeline reference the new key from the Vaultner secret path, not an inline value. The old key is revoked at end of day. The replacement key for staging use is below.

service key, yadug-bajog: zpat3_pou

Runbook: Scanline barcode bridge

If warehouse scans stop flowing into Cartwheel, it's almost always the bridge service on the Dunmore floor box wedging after a USB hiccup. Bounce the service first — nine times out of ten that fixes it. If not, check the queue depth before escalating. When restarting, make sure the bridge comes up with these settings.

deployment values, yafop-bajef:
[gilok]
team = ulaius
access_code = ac_423664
host = gilok.sivrelhq.corp
port = 9200
owner = pelius.istax
peer = eliok.torvasoft.internal

Ticket: Crashline vault locked after failed rotation

Hey, flagging this for security review. The Crashline pipeline (our mobile crash-report ingest at Bevant Labs) can't decrypt symbol files because the vault auto-locked after three bad unlock attempts during Tuesday's key rotation. Ingest is queuing, nothing lost yet, but dSYM processing is stalled. Per runbook section 4, recovery requires the passphrase held by the platform team. For the reviewer's convenience, it is included below.

unlock words, yawig-kagef: gordor-holvan-ulaael-pramir-ulaiel-tamdor